 +====== Placing Objects ======
 +
 +Start the editor and choose your terrain.
 +
 +Go to assets browser (R key to turn it on/off).
 +
 +Click F1 or objects icon, click Props icon. This is for placing objects like buildings.
 +
 +Double click PMC Opteryx Objects category open. Open sub category like Buildings Large, click object doesn't matter which one, then just click on the 3D viewport to place this object type.
 +
 +All done.
 +
 +
 +====== Placing Compositions ======
 +
 +Go to assets browser (R key to turn it on/off).
 +
 +Click F2 or Compositions icon, click Custom icon. This is custom compositions which you must do yourself or download from the internet.
 +
 +Once you have custom composition selected, just click on the 3D viewport to place one.
 +
 +All done.
